Step 1: Inspection

Assessing the situation carefully, our crew identifies the source of the leak and the affected area. This step is crucial in determining the best course of action. We’ll take note of any structural damage, water accumulation, and potential safety hazards.

Step 2: Water Extraction

Using high-capacity pumps and industrial-grade wet vacuums our team extracts the water from the affected area. This process helps prevent further damage and reduces the risk of mold growth.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Industrial-grade dehumidifiers and air movers are used to dry the area, ensuring that both the structure and contents are fully restored. This step is critical in preventing secondary damage and potential health hazards.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

Using antimicrobial cleaning agents and disinfectants our crew thoroughly cleans and sanitizes the affected area, ensuring that all surfaces are free from bacteria, mold, and mildew.

Step 5: Monitoring and Repair

Monitoring the area for any signs of water damage or potential health hazards, our team will make any necessary repairs to ensure your property is restored to its original condition.

Warning Signs You Need Shower Leak Water Removal

You might be experiencing some of these warning signs, and not addressing them quickly can lead to more significant problems and costly repairs. Our team can help you identify and mitigate these risks before they become major issues.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Don’t ignore the musty smell from your shower; it’s a sign of moisture accumulation, which can lead to mold growth. Our team will help you remove the source of the odor and prevent further damage.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age from your shower leak. Our team will assess the extent of the damage and provide a plan to restore your flooring to its original condition.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age or high humidity levels. Our team will help you identify the source of the issue and provide a solution to restore your walls to their original condition.

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ls

Water stains on ceilings or walls can be a sign of a shower leak or high water pressure. Our team will help you identify the source of the issue and provide a plan to restore your ceilings and walls to their original condition.

Unpleasant Odors or Fumes

Unpleasant odors or fumes from your shower can be a sign of mold growth or poor ventilation. Our team will help you identify the source of the issue and provide a solution to remove the odor and prevent further damage.

Visible Water Damage or Leaks

Visible water damage or leaks from your shower can be a sign of a serious issue that needs immediate attention. Our team will help you identify the source of the leak and provide a plan to restore your shower to its original condition.

Shower Leak Water Removal Cost In Orange, CA

The cost of Shower Leak Water Removal in Orange, CA, varies based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on average costs and may vary depending on the specifics of your situation. Our team will provide a free on-site assessment to find out the exact cost of the service.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,000 The size of the affected area and the amount of water extracted affect the cost.
Drying and Dehumidification $300 – $1,500 The size of the affected area and the duration of the drying process affect the cost.
Cleaning and Sanitizing $200 – $1,000 The size of the affected area and the level of contamination affect the cost.
Monitoring and Repair $100 – $500 The extent of the damage and the required repairs affect the cost.
Emergency Service Fee $200 – $500 The urgency of the situation and the time of day affect the cost.
Free On-Site Assessment $0 Our team provides a free on-site assessment to find out the exact cost of the service.

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ates for all services.

Common Questions About Shower Leak Water Removal

Will Insurance Cover the Cost of Shower Leak Water Removal?

Yes, insurance may cover the cost of Shower Leak Water Removal, but the specifics depend on your policy and the circumstances of the damage. Our team will help you navigate the insurance process and ensure you receive fair compensation.

How Long Does Shower Leak Water Removal Typically Take?

Our team works efficiently to reduce downtime but the duration of the service depends on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. Typically, Shower Leak Water Removal takes 3-5 days to complete, but in some cases, it can take longer.

Is Mold Growth a Concern After Shower Leak Water Removal?

Mold growth is a risk after Shower Leak Water Removal if the area is not properly dried and sanitized. Our team uses industrial-grade equipment and antimicrobial cleaning agents to prevent mold growth and ensure a safe environment.

Do I Need to Displace My Family During Shower Leak Water Removal?

No, you don’t need to displace your family but it’s essential to keep the affected area isolated to prevent further damage and health hazards. Our team will work with you to reduce disruptions and ensure a safe environment for your family.

How Do I Prevent Future Shower Leaks?

Prevention is key to avoiding future shower leaks. Regular maintenance, inspecting your shower for signs of wear, and addressing any issues quickly can help prevent future leaks. Our team can provide guidance on how to maintain your shower to prevent future issues.
